[已解决]OSPF与RIP重分发 问题
本帖最后由 Chaochao 于 2009-8-11 09:55 编辑不会发图,手绘一个拓扑如下:
运行OSPF 运行 RIP
F0/0: 192.168.1.1/24 S0/0: 172.16.1.1/24
LOOP 0:192.168.11.129/25
LOOP 0:192.168.11.1/25 LOOP 0:1.1.1.1/24
R1————————————————————R2————————————————————R3
F0/0:192.168.1.2/24 S0/0:172.16.1.2/24
将172.16.0.0/16汇总通告进OSPF,因为路由重分发,结果172.16.0.0/16又以OSPF被重分发进RIP中,所以:R1,R3中都出现172.16.0.0/16
但将192.168.11.0/24汇总通告进RIP,而这条汇总路由又不会以RIP重分发进OSPF,结果只有R3中出现192.168.11.0/24,R1无
1:是因为OSPF无水平分割,而RIP有水平分割的原因吗??
是的话为什么我在RIP中将水平分割关闭掉了,R1中还是无192.168.11.0/24这条路由?
2:还有在OSPF中重分发直连,将1.1.1.0/24通告进OSPF, 既然OSPF无水平分割,为什么这条路由又不会被重分发进RIP中?? OSPF 有SPLIT HORZION ,很不辛这个还是CCIE 面试题目
OSPF 的水平分割是用于ABR上不将LSA 3 回馈到始发区域
你这里描述的不是很清楚,你明显出现了路由回馈现象
还有重分发本身会判断时候产生基本的路由回馈,希望你把你的步骤帖出来
(发现你做的实验和问的问题都比较有质量,呵呵继续加油阿) 恩恩~~非常感谢``
在R2上将OSPF与RIP互相重分发
1. 这里OSPF没有ABR,是通过在ASBR即R2上summary-address 172.16.0.0/16将汇总通告进OSPF,但汇总回馈到RIP里了 (R3中也出现了172.16.0.0/16这条路由,这条路由原本是汇总通告给OSPF的)
2. 在R2的F0/0接口ip summary-address rip 192.168.11.0/24将汇总通告进RIP,但为什么这个汇总又不会回馈到OSPF中 (即R1中没有出现192.168.11..0/24路由)
3. 在R2的OSPF进程中redistruibute connect将1.1.1.0/24也发布进OSPF里, 为什么1.1.1.0/24又不会随ospf重发布进rip中?(R3中无1.1.1.0/24这条路由) 果然是汇总
OSPF EIGRP ISIS BGP 汇总后都会有本地的NULLO 汇空条目
这些条目都会在重分发的时候被分发出去
所以在做REDISTRIBUTE 的时候要过滤它 本帖最后由 tianchunyu 于 2009-8-10 17:45 编辑
还原一下你的配置,你看下你是不是这样配置的:
R2:
router ospf x
net 192.168.1.0 0.0.0.255 ar 0
summary-address 172.16.0.0 255.255.0.0 ------------第一重要点
redistribute rip subnets
redistribute connneted
router rip
ver 2---------------------------------------------------第二重要点
no au ---------------这个有没有无所谓
net 172.16.0.0
redistribute ospf x metricX 不错~~我就喜欢春雨你这个样子~~苏嘎 本帖最后由 tianchunyu 于 2009-8-10 17:48 编辑
如果是这样的话 那么答案只有一句话:重分发基于路由表,且此种情况在RIP V1下不会出现;如果不是,再行讨论 good 春哥发标??? 本帖最后由 okulao 于 2009-8-10 20:25 编辑
还原一下你的配置,你看下你是不是这样配置的:
R2:
router ospf x
net 192.168.1.0 0.0.0.255 ar 0
summary-address 172.16.0.0 255.255.0.0 ------------第一重要点
redistribute rip subnets
redistribute ...
tianchunyu 发表于 2009-8-10 17:34 http://bbs.spoto.net/images/common/back.gif
配置完全正确 加多个
int f0/0
ip summary-address rip 192.168.11.0 255.255.255.0
感谢各位仁兄指点 ··
这么说之所以汇总到rip的路由没有在OSPF域中出现是因为RIP汇总路由不会产生一个指向NULL的空路由 ???对吗?
不过对R3为什么没有1.1.1.0这路由依然不懂。R2都已经将它重发布进OSPF了,为什么不会再由OSPF重发布进RIP ??
完整配置:
R2:
interface FastEthernet0/0
ip address 192.168.1.2 255.255.255.0
ip summary-address rip 192.168.11.0 255.255.255.0
duplex auto
speed auto
!
router ospf 100
log-adjacency-changes
summary-address 172.16.0.0 255.255.0.0
redistribute connected metric 10 subnets
redistribute rip metric 20 subnets
network 192.168.1.0 0.0.0.255 area 0
!
router rip
version 2
redistribute ospf 100 metric 2
network 172.16.0.0
!
路由表
R1
Gateway of last resort is not set
1.0.0.0/24 is subnetted, 1 subnets
O E2 1.1.1.0 via 192.168.1.2, 00:14:14, FastEthernet0/0
O E2 172.16.0.0/16 via 192.168.1.2, 00:12:18, FastEthernet0/0
192.168.11.0/25 is subnetted, 2 subnets
C 192.168.11.0 is directly connected, Loopback1
C 192.168.11.128 is directly connected, Loopback0
C 192.168.1.0/24 is directly connected, FastEthernet0/0
R2
Gateway of last resort is not set
1.0.0.0/24 is subnetted, 1 subnets
C 1.1.1.0 is directly connected, Loopback0
172.16.0.0/16 is variably subnetted, 2 subnets, 2 masks
O 172.16.0.0/16 is a summary, 00:00:14, Null0
C 172.16.1.0/24 is directly connected, Serial0/0
192.168.11.0/32 is subnetted, 2 subnets
O 192.168.11.1 via 192.168.1.1, 00:02:21, FastEthernet0/0
O 192.168.11.129 via 192.168.1.1, 00:02:21, FastEthernet0/0
C 192.168.1.0/24 is directly connected, FastEthernet0/0
R3
Gateway of last resort is not set
172.16.0.0/16 is variably subnetted, 2 subnets, 2 masks
R 172.16.0.0/16 via 172.16.1.1, 00:00:02, Serial0/1
C 172.16.1.0/24 is directly connected, Serial0/1
R 192.168.11.0/24 via 172.16.1.1, 00:00:02, Serial0/1
R 192.168.1.0/24 via 172.16.1.1, 00:00:02, Serial0/1
页:
[1]
2